it doesn't matter if it's a gay or straight relationship. jealousy usually morphs into something worse. my ex was (still is) a jealous person. she had no reason to be. she was also a control freak (and also a liar. and critical). this makes for a very stressful relationship for anyone. and chipped away at my self-esteem until I was depressed and I gained weight and endangered my physical as well as mental health. I had to end things for my own sanity. I'm in a very happy relationship now.
if you are a good friend, you can talk to him about your concerns. tell him how much you care and want him to be happy....there is someone better out there for him.
